Cheltenham Spa is equipped with a robust ticketing service, featuring both manned ticket offices and machines for purchasing and collecting tickets with ease. The ticket office is open from 06:15 to 20:15 on weekdays, slightly altering times over the weekend. Furthermore, smartcards can be issued at this station, though they lack on-site validators.
Accessibility is made a priority at this station, with step-free access to platforms via ramps, and there are provisions for customers needing extra assistance with a dedicated help point. For those carrying heavy luggage, it's important to note that there isn’t a luggage storage facility available. However, customer service staff are on hand from 05:00 to 01:00 daily to assist whenever needed.
Parking is handled by APCOA Parking, offering 286 spaces, 17 of which are wheelchair-accessible. Though the car park is monitored, it doesn't feature CCTV. The rates are reasonable and include a variety of payment plans to suit different needs. Meanwhile, cyclists can benefit from 134 cycle storage spaces and hire services offered by Compass Holidays.
Cheltenham Spa station serves as a critical intersection for various modes of transport besides trains, easing the transition from rail to other transport forms. In case of rail service disruptions, a replacement service is available just in front of the station. Taxis are conveniently stationed at the entrance, though an accessible taxi requires a staff member's help to arrange.
For avid cyclists, bike hire is operational on the platform, offering excellent routes and experiences through Compass Holidays. While those keen on exploring surroundings can access local bus services, with comprehensive onwards travel information available to download in a printable format.

When it comes to amenities, Walthamstow Central offers a variety of essential services. The ticket office operates Monday through Saturday from 06:00 to 21:00, and slightly later on Sundays, closing at 21:30. For those who prefer modern conveniences, ticket machines are readily available and accessible for everyone. Whether you've purchased your tickets online or at the station, collection is efficient and straightforward.
Accessibility is key, and while Walthamstow Central provides step-free access for the London Overground platforms, do note that some parts of the journey may require a short travel via street level. Customer service is anchored by staffed help points and helpful staff available from as early as 05:04 on weekdays to assist with any inquiries. Surveillance is keen here with CCTV ensuring enhanced safety.
Traveling from Walthamstow Central station is made easy with a blend of local and city-wide connections. The station is seamlessly integrated into London’s vast transportation network. It connects to the London Underground through the Victoria Line, providing quick access to central London areas. Besides the underground, a multitude of bus routes serve the station, ensuring that wherever you're heading, a bus is likely going your way. These buses operate directly from outside the station, adding convenience to your journey.
Furthermore, for onward travel and convenience, taxis are available at the station's front, offering a quick escape to your desired destination. The station also plays a pivotal role when services require rail replacement, with designated bus stops for alternate services readily marked to direct you efficiently.
